Performance-Installation series
2023 / 2024 / 2025
La Plasti Ciudad del Cuerpo is a performance-installation series in which the artist fuses discarded objects found in public spaces with her body, transforming them into ephemeral architectural figures. Through an intuitive process, these accumulated objects create a visual excess, a representation of the urban environment. The body and the objects communicate through a constant negotiation between functionality and displacement, creating temporary architectural compositions.
Over time, the series has been transforming, adapting to different contexts and exhibition spaces. Each new action reconfigures the relationship between body, object, and architecture, incorporating materials from the immediate surroundings and expanding the research on the boundaries between the performative and the sculptural. This evolution reflects an artistic practice that redefines itself in dialogue with space, residue, and presence.
From this body-object mutability, the artist subtly captures the debris, holding the figures for as long as possible, like ruins in the landscape.
Description:
-
Solo performance designed for non-conventional, public spaces and galleries. A space of at least 9m2 is required for the installation of the objects.
-
As the work is based on improvisation, each presentation is different, as is the selection of the objects used.
-
As a primary procedure for the action, a few days before the presentation, the artist collects these discarded objects from the urban environment, collected in different areas of the city where the work is presented. During this short period of time, there is a kind of coexistence with this accumulation, thus generating a closeness between the artist and the objects. The criterion for selecting the objects is that they all have a moderate size, even if they are of different natures, so that the artist can hold them on her body during the action. All the objects are painted blue.
-
The audience can stand around the performer, even circulate during the action. It's allowed to enter and leave the space at any time. After the performance time has passed, the performer leaves the space.
